Course Content

• Myasthenia Gravis: Pathophysiology and Clinical Presentation
• Cholinergic Pharmacology in Myasthenia Gravis: Acetylcholinesterase Inhibitors
• Immunomodulatory Therapies for Myasthenia Gravis: Mechanism of Action and Clinical Use
• Management of Myasthenic Crises and Cholinergic Crises: Differential Diagnosis and Treatment
• Pharmacotherapy of Myasthenia Gravis: Individualized Treatment Strategies
• Adverse Effects and Drug Interactions in Myasthenia Gravis Medications
• Monitoring Treatment Response in Myasthenia Gravis: Clinical and Laboratory Assessments
• Emerging Therapies and Future Directions in Myasthenia Gravis Treatment
